DESCRIPTION:Join us for a performance of New Blood on Tuesday\, September 30\, 2025 at Bert Church Theatre in Airdrie. A commemoration event for the National Day for Truth and Reconciliation. \nThis powerful play celebrates Siksika (Blackfoot) history and traditions. It is inspired by the life of Chief Vincent Yellow Old Woman and his experience as a residential school survivor who went on to become Chief of Siksika Nation. \nTickets can be purchased at tickets.airdrie.ca. DESCRIPTION:The park is now OPEN on Sundays\, 11AM to 4PM\, for the 2025 season. \nAbout us – What is Iron Horse Park? \nThe miniature trains\, track and landscape at Iron Horse Park represent the Canadian Pacific Railway (CPR) from the prairies to the coast. Take the 1.6km interpretive journey aboard one of the 1/8th scale diesel or steam locomotives at the park and get a feeling of what the railway was like in Western Canada during the pioneer days. The journey will take you over hills\, across trestles and through tunnels across the varied landscape. \nAdmission to the park is free. The cost of journeys is $3.00 each. We accept Visa\, MasterCard and Debit cards at the register! Cash is still accepted as well. Children 2 years of age and under ride for free but must be accompanied by an adult. Children under 10 must be accompanied by an adult or an older responsible person.. \nSnacks and souvenirs can be found in the full size replica of a CPR station on site. Picnic tables on site provide a place for small family gatherings. \nNO PETS ALLOWED. Also\, Smoking\, Alcoholic Beverages\, and Private BBQ’s or Hibachis are not permitted on the site on public run days. \nThe park is leased from the City of Airdrie and operated by the Alberta Model Engineering Society\, which was incorporated in 1971. DESCRIPTION:The City of Airdrie invites the community to attend the official dedication of the Veterans Memorial. This meaningful ceremony will honour the courage\, sacrifice and service of local Veterans. \nDate: Sept. 20\, 2025Time: 1 – 2 p.m.Location: Veterans Boulevard Nautical Flag Pole (along Veterans Boulevard near 8 st.)Parking: Parking is very limited. Attendees are encouraged to use active transportation such as walking\, biking or scootering where possible. \nThe Veterans Memorial\, developed in collaboration with the Royal Canadian Legion #288 Airdrie and the Army\, Navy and Airforce Veterans in Canada (ANAVETS)\, features custom-designed artistic pieces inspired by the stories of local Veterans. It includes: \n• 22 metal banners mounted on light poles along Veterans Boulevard• 30 metal railing panels along the sidewalk leading to the Veterans Boulevard pedestrian underpass• Two artistic benches on either side of the Veterans Boulevard pedestrian underpass• Two life-sized silhouettes located on the corners of Veterans and 8 St and Veterans and Main St.• One nautical flagpole located near 8 St. along Veterans Boulevard• Two painted sidewalks located by the Royal Canadian Legion #288 Airdrie and Field of Valour Park \nThe City\, along with the Royal Canadian Legion #288\, gratefully acknowledge the Government of Alberta for its contribution towards development of the Veterans Memorial as well as Veterans Affairs Canada for its contribution towards the memorial’s dedication ceremony. \nFurther information on the Veterans Memorial can be found at airdrie.ca/veteransmemorial.
